1. What Cookies Are

A cookie is a small text file that a website stores on your browser or device when you visit. It allows the website to recognise your device on a return visit and, depending on the cookie, to remember certain information about your visit.

Cookies may be set by the website you are visiting (first-party cookies) or by third-party services that the website loads, such as analytics tools (third-party cookies). They may remain for the duration of your browser session only (session cookies) or for a longer fixed period (persistent cookies).

Through your browser

You can also manage, block, or delete cookies through your browser settings. Instructions for the most common browsers:

  • Google Chrome: Settings → Privacy and security → Cookies and other site data
  • Mozilla Firefox: Settings → Privacy & Security → Cookies and Site Data
  • Microsoft Edge: Settings → Cookies and site permissions → Manage and delete cookies and site data
  • Safari (macOS): Preferences → Privacy → Manage Website Data
  • Safari (iOS): Settings → Safari → Advanced → Website Data

Blocking all cookies may affect how some websites function. Blocking cookies on this website will not prevent you from using the site, but the cookie notice may reappear on each visit.
